Yesterday I experienced two very different extremes of customer service.

Here's a little background information on the first story...

Last week I went to our local Hot Dollar variety store to purchase a few extra gifts for our school Mother's Day stall.  This store would have to be one of my favourites as it always seems that when I have looked all over for something I go there and they have it (you think I'd figure out to go there first wouldn't you !!)  So I spent up big buying multiples of various items for the stall.  I was in a rush, as usual, so when I saw a cute little melamine tray for $2.50 I just picked up the whole bunch of them together and added them to my shopping.

Well when I arrived at the school for Mother's Day wrapping I realized that one of the trays was broken...which then led me to take a closer look at the remaining trays and I saw that a dozen of them had a tiny crack near the handle....in fact you would never have seen it if you weren't specifically looking for it.

So yesterday I went with my receipt in hand to return the damaged trays....only to be met with the barrage of abuse from the shopkeeper...okay so most of the conversation was to her son in another language but seriously the tone and volume she used indicated that she was none too happy with my suggestion that the items were damaged when I bought them.  Seriously I would not waste my time returning a dozen trays for the sheer fun of it.  I tried to reason with her and her son as you could only see the crack if you were really analysing the trays.  Whilst I'm pretty sure that her son believed my side of the story there was no way that the lady was having it and she simply concluded the shopping experience by loudly accusing me of dropping the trays on the ground and trying to bring them back for a refund.

I have been shopping there for years, I have purchased in bulk for the past few Mother's Day and Father's Day stalls, birthday parties and the like but I will not be returning to that store again....yep that is my teeny tiny personal protest!!

So much for the customer always being right!!  I can appreciate that people would possibly try to return things that we broken after purchase etc.. but it is up to the shopkeeper to use their discretion...and at least be civil.
